Photographic medium refers to the tools and techniques used in creating photographic images. There are several synonyms for photographic medium, including photographic process, photographic technique, photo imaging, photo printing, and photo development. These terms are all used to describe the various methods and processes used to capture and develop photographs. Additionally, other terms such as film, digital camera, darkroom, and printing press may be used in conjunction with photographic medium to describe the specific tools or equipment used in the production of photographs. Understanding the various synonyms for photographic medium can help photographers and enthusiasts better communicate and describe their craft.
